English Language & Literature at Brigham Young University - Provo

If you plan to study English language and literature, take a look at what Brigham Young University - Provo has to offer and decide if the program is a good match for you. Get started with the following essential facts.

BYU is located in Provo, Utah and approximately 36,461 students attend the school each year.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 143 students received a bachelor's degree in English language and literature from BYU.

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 143 English language and literature majors earned their bachelor's degree from BYU. Of these graduates, 24% were men and 76% were women.

undefined

About 89% of those who receive a bachelor's degree in English language and literature at BYU are white. This is above average for this degree on the nationwide level.

Careers That English Language & Literature Grads May Go Into

A degree in English language and literature can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for UT, the home state for Brigham Young University - Provo.

Occupation Jobs in UT Average Salary in UT
High School Teachers 10,170 $59,070
Editors 960 $60,990
English Language and Literature Professors 830 $75,410
Technical Writers 750 $66,940
Writers and Authors 660 $54,660
